English
Language : 

MC68HC12D60 Datasheet, PDF (99/432 Pages) Motorola, Inc – Advance Information - Rev 4.0
Freescale Semiconductor, Inc.
Advance Information — 68HC(9)12D60
Section 7. Flash Memory
7.1 Contents
7.2 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 99
7.3 Overview.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.100
7.4 Flash EEPROM Control Block . . . . . . . . . . . . . . . . . . . . . . . .100
7.5 Flash EEPROM Arrays .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.100
7.6 Flash EEPROM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. 101
7.7 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.105
7.8 Programming the Flash EEPROM . . . . . . . . . . . . . . . . . . . . . 108
7.9 Erasing the Flash EEPROM . . . . . . . . . . . . . . . . . . . . . . . . . . 111
7.10 Program/Erase Protection Interlocks . . . . . . . . . . . . . . . . . . .113
7.11 Stop or Wait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.113
7.2 Introduction
The two Flash EEPROM modules (32-Kbyte and 28-Kbyte) for the
68HC912D60 serve as electrically erasable and programmable, non-
volatile ROM emulation memory. The modules can be used for program
code that must either execute at high speed or is frequently executed,
such as operating system kernels and standard subroutines, or they can
be used for static data which is read frequently. The Flash EEPROM is
ideal for program storage for single-chip applications allowing for field
reprogramming.
68HC(9)12D60 — Rev 4.0
MOTOROLA
Flash Memory
For More Information On This Product,
Go to: www.freescale.com
Advance Information
99